Why Create a Printable All About My Child Catholic?
As a Catholic parent, you want to nurture your child's faith and create lasting memories of their spiritual journey. One beautiful way to do this is by creating a printable all about my child Catholic keepsake. This thoughtful and personalized document allows you to record your child's milestones, prayers, and special moments, making it a treasured family heirloom for years to come.
The printable all about my child Catholic template typically includes spaces to record your child's baptism, first communion, and confirmation, as well as their favorite prayers, saints, and Bible verses. You can also include photos, artwork, and other mementos to make it an extra-special keepsake. By filling out this template, you'll be able to reflect on your child's faith journey and see how they've grown in their relationship with God.

Tips for Personalizing Your Printable All About My Child Catholic To make your printable all about my child Catholic keepsake even more special, consider adding personal touches such as your child's artwork, handwriting, or favorite quotes. You could also include photos of special moments, such as baptisms, first communions, or family vacations to Catholic shrines or pilgrimage sites. By adding these personal details, you'll be able to create a truly unique and meaningful keepsake that reflects your child's individuality and spirituality.
